Not to be confused with the nom de plume of author Nora Roberts, meet the real J.D. Robb.

In 1941, at the age of 49, John Donald Robb walked away from a successful international law career, headed West, set up shop in Albuquerque, New Mexico and later founded the Rio Grande Electronic Music Laboratory.

Robb dove head first into a career as a composer, ethnomusicologist and an early electronic music noodler whose bizarre & singular electronic music recordings are short on same old same old and long on quirky, propulsive beat audacity.This collection of vintage electronic experiments is a true pleasure to the inner sanctum of the outer ear. Newly remastered compilation combining the best cuts from his two folkways lps with totally off the wall photos.
